Understanding Throttle Bodies and Resetting Them

Throttle bodies are essential parts of your car's engine. They control how much air enters through its intake valves, directly impacting power output and efficiency.

By pressing your accelerator pedal, openings in your throttle body allow more air into your engine to mix with fuel for combustion—powering your car!

Over time, throttle bodies can accumulate carbon deposits and debris, which impedes their performance and leads to issues with rough idling, poor acceleration, or increased fuel consumption.

Sometimes, the electronic control module (ECM) misinterprets signals from the throttle body due to these deposits, leading to inconsistent performance or even triggering "Check Engine" light warnings.

Resetting the throttle body can help resolve these issues by recalibrating the ECM to understand better its actual position and behaviour of the throttle body.

This process helps identify any misalignments or errors within the system and restore optimal engine performance.

Selecting an OBD2 Scanner to Reset Throttle Bodies

Selecting an OBD2 scanner with specific capabilities is paramount when resetting your throttle body.

Only some scanners can handle this challenge, so knowing which features to look for can save time and effort later.

First and foremost, you need a scanner equipped with advanced service functions. Primary code readers may provide insight into what's wrong, but they can't reset specific elements like throttle body reset.

Look for scanners that specifically mention service functions or actuator tests; these enable communication with the car's electronic control module (ECM), allowing it to precisely reset and recalibrate throttle bodies.

Another key feature is bidirectional control. This means the scanner can read data from your car and send commands directly.

For instance, to reset a throttle body properly, a bidirectional scanner would instruct the ECM to relearn its position—something only a unidirectional scanner can accomplish.

Compatibility is another essential consideration when selecting a scanner for your vehicle.

When shopping around for scanners, make sure they support both your vehicle's make and model and any specific brands or regions—this is particularly essential when dealing with more complex or specialized systems on board.

Finally, take into account the user interface of your scanner.

A clear and intuitive user interface will make the entire throttle body reset process much smoother; no time should be lost trying to figure out how to navigate this tool when trying to get your car running again.

Look for one with simple instructions and responsive screens so you can complete it confidently.

By considering these features, you can select an OBD2 scanner that excels at general diagnostics and is equipped to effectively manage throttle body resets.

Steps for Resetting Your Throttle Body With an OBD2 Scanner

Now, let's discuss resetting your throttle body using the Foxwell NT809. While the process shouldn't be complicated, you must follow all necessary steps carefully for the best results.

Connect the Scanner: Begin by plugging the NT809 into the OBD2 port located under your dashboard near the steering column and plugging in. Once attached, turn on your ignition without starting the engine. This step allows time for any necessary diagnostic checks and engine diagnostics to run successfully.

Access the Throttle Body Reset Function: On your NT809's touchscreen, navigate to the "Service" menu. There, select the "Throttle Relearn" function, which is specifically designed to recalibrate the throttle body by communicating directly with the car's ECM.

Follow the Prompts: The NT809 will guide you through the process with easy on-screen instructions, prompting you to press your accelerator pedal or perform other simple tasks to help retrain ECM to reconfigure throttle body positions accurately. This allows ECM to relearn proper placement.

After Initiating Reset: Once initiated, the NT809 will inform you when it has completed the reset process and advise you to turn off the ignition for several seconds before restarting the engine.

Test Drive: After performing a reset, take your car for a short drive so the ECM can adapt to its newly calibrated throttle body settings under actual driving conditions. You should notice smoother idling, improved acceleration and overall improved performance.

Following these steps with the Foxwell NT809 lets you quickly and efficiently reset your throttle body without visiting a mechanic. It's easy with all the right tools at your fingertips, and your car will soon be running like new!

What to Expect After Resetting Your Throttle Body

After you've reset the throttle body, it is common for the vehicle's performance to vary temporarily due to the ECM relearning its behaviour and adjusting the air-fuel mixture accordingly.

This process typically takes only minutes of driving time before the final adjustment can take place.

After you reset the throttle body, you should notice an improvement in the issues that led you to do it, such as smoother idling, more responsive acceleration, and possibly improved fuel efficiency.

If problems continue, however, this could indicate damage to the throttle body itself or other underlying engine issues.

Common Issues and Troubleshooting After Throttle Body Reset

While resetting your throttle body can solve many problems, occasionally, the reset may not resolve all your concerns. Here are some issues and troubleshooting tips after resetting:

  • Persistent Rough Idling: If rough idling persists after resetting, it could be due to a dirty or malfunctioning idle air control valve, which requires cleaning or replacement.
  • Check Engine Light: Remains On If the check engine light remains illuminated after being reset, using your OBD2 scanner to read its trouble codes may help diagnose what the cause could be, such as other sensors or components needing repair.
  • Acceleration Inconsistent: If acceleration remains inconsistent, your throttle body needs cleaning, or the accelerator pedal position sensor could be defective.
  • Fuel Efficiency Issues: If resetting the throttle body doesn't increase fuel efficiency, other factors could be at play, such as clogged injectors or a malfunctioning oxygen sensor.

When your vehicle's performance suddenly drops, using an OBD2 scanner to gather more data and pinpoint its root cause can be extremely helpful in finding solutions quickly and cost-effectively.

When necessary, professional mechanics should also be brought in for assistance to ensure everything runs smoothly again.

FAQs

Can you reprogram ECU with OBD2?

No, most OBD2 scanners cannot reprogram the ECU. ECU reprogramming requires specialized tools and software that are typically more advanced than standard OBD2 scanners.

What scan tool can reprogram PCM?

To reprogram a PCM, you need a professional-grade scan tool, often referred to as a J2534 pass-thru device, or manufacturer-specific tools like Ford IDS, GM Tech 2, or Chrysler WiTech. These tools are designed for advanced functions like reprogramming.

Can you reset ECU with scan tool?

Yes, many OBD2 scan tools can reset the ECU by clearing the error codes and resetting adaptive learning values, but this is different from reprogramming the ECU.
